Understanding the Role of an Injury Lawsuit Lawyer
An injury lawsuit lawyer is a lawyer who provides legal representation to those who declare to have actually been injured, physically or emotionally, as an outcome of the carelessness or misbehavior of another individual, company, government firm, or other entity.
Their primary goal is to protect payment (called "damages") for their customers to cover medical expenses, rehabilitation, lost income, and pain and suffering.
Core Responsibilities of an Injury Attorney:
- Case Evaluation: Assessing the benefits of a case based upon liability, damages, and readily available proof.
- Examination: Gathering police reports, medical records, witness statements, and professional testaments.
- Settlement: Communicating and negotiating strongly with insurance provider for a reasonable settlement.
- Lawsuits: Filing a formal claim, carrying out discovery, and representing the customer in a law court if a settlement can not be reached.
When Should You Hire a Lawyer?
Not every small scrape or fender-bender requires the services of an attorney. However, particular circumstances require the expertise of a certified injury claim lawyer.
Common Scenarios Requiring Legal Representation:
- Severe or Permanent Injuries: If the injury leads to long-term disability, disfigurement, or substantial rehab, computing the future cost of care is complicated and requires legal competence.
- Contested Liability: When the other celebration or their insurer rejects fault, a lawyer is necessary for collecting the proof required to prove neglect.
- Numerous Parties Involved: Accidents involving industrial trucks, several cars, or malfunctioning items often feature linked liabilities that are challenging to untangle without legal help.
- Insurance Bad Faith: If an insurance provider acts unreasonably by rejecting a legitimate claim, delaying payment, or using an unbelievably low settlement, a lawyer can take legal action against them.
- Wrongful Death: If an enjoyed one passes away due to someone else's negligence, surviving relative should immediately speak with an attorney to file a wrongful death claim.

How much does an injury claim lawyer cost? The majority of injury lawyers operate on a contingency fee basis. This indicates you pay absolutely nothing upfront. Rather, the lawyer takes an agreed-upon percentage(typically in between 33%and 40% )of the last settlement or court award. If you recover nothing, you owe them no lawyer costs. 2. How long do I have to submit a personal injury suit? Every state has a time frame referred to as the statute of constraints
. For most individual injury cases, this window varies from one to 3 years from the date of the Accident Claim Attorney. Stopping working to submit within this timeframe generally disallows you from ever recovering settlement. 3. Will my case go to trial? Statistically, the large bulk of injury cases (around 90% to 95%) are settled out of court through settlement or mediation. However, working with a lawyer who is completely prepared to take your case to trial offers you significant take advantage of during settlement conversations, as insurance provider understand the attorneyis not scared to face them in court. 4. What kind of damages can I recover? Victims can generally look for two primary kinds of countervailing damages: Economic Damages: Objectively proven losses such as medical costs, property damage, lost wages,
and loss of future earning capacity.
Non-Economic Damages: Subjective losses such as discomfort and suffering, psychological distress, loss of consortium, and loss of satisfaction of life.
